INSERT INTO assignComm(assignCommId,teacherId,assignmentId,toObject,objectId,created,voice,description,status,memo,voicelen)
VALUES (
(SELECT NEXTVAL('seq_assignCommId')),
#{assignCommId},
#{teacherId},#{assignmentId},#{toObject},#{objectId},#{created},#{voice},#{description},#{status},#{memo},#{voicelen})
INSERT INTO assignComm(assignCommId,teacherId,assignmentId,toObject,objectId,created,voice,description,status,memo,voicelen,tier,badge,medias)
VALUES (
(SELECT NEXTVAL('seq_assignCommId')),
#{assignCommId},
#{teacherId},#{assignmentId},#{toObject},#{objectId},#{created},#{voice},#{description},#{status},#{memo},#{voicelen},#{tier},#{badge},#{medias,typeHandler=com._3e.http.wrongbook.typehandler.JSONTypeHandlerPg})
Update assignComm
teacherId = #{teacherId},
assignmentId = #{assignmentId},
toObject = #{toObject},
objectId = #{objectId},
created = #{created},
voice = #{voice},
description = #{description},
status = #{status},
memo = #{memo},
voicelen = #{voicelen}
WHERE assignCommId = #{assignCommId}
Update assignComm
teacherId = #{teacherId},
assignmentId = #{assignmentId},
toObject = #{toObject},
objectId = #{objectId},
created = #{created},
voice = #{voice},
description = #{description},
status = #{status},
memo = #{memo},
voicelen = #{voicelen},
tier = #{tier},
badge = #{badge},
medias = #{medias,typeHandler=com._3e.http.wrongbook.typehandler.JSONTypeHandlerPg}
WHERE assignCommId = #{assignCommId}
update assignComm set tier= #{tier} where toObject = 1 and assignmentId = #{assignmentId} and objectId = #{objectId}
update assignComm set badge= #{badge} where toObject = 1 and assignmentId = #{assignmentId} and objectId = #{objectId}